The shopping was FAB! We have totally different body types so we both played "Angie" for each other (or tried to) when we weren't considering our own wishes. I personally find it brings me out of my own self-criticism to think about what works for someone else's body type - after all we're all different and it's OK. We discussed what colors work best for each of us. Shiny is better in cooler tones and I'm better in warmer ones. We discussed how difficult it is to find gloves made for short fingers, and how so many of the attractive coats in stores now are not really warm enough for our climate unless you are just dashing from a heated apt to a heated garage/car to a heated office.

We both tried on this teddy bear coat (find 1) at Anthropologie and adored the color , but found the sleeves too long in all sizes. No surprise since it's not a petite, and would have been an easy fix if either of us had wanted to keep it. I was surprised at how bulky this coat was NOT, so my opinion of these faux fur coats has changed a bit. The name of the color is "tayberry", which I had to look up, turns out it's a cross between a raspberry and a blackberry, named after a river in Scotland. shiny tried on these lace-up boots (find 2).
